EXACTLY WHAT IS WEBSITE SCRAPING AND SO HOW EXACTLY DOES IT OPERATE?

Exactly what is Website Scraping and So how exactly does It Operate?

Exactly what is Website Scraping and So how exactly does It Operate?

Blog Article

Net scraping, often known as World wide web facts extraction or World-wide-web harvesting, is the whole process of automating the retrieval of knowledge from websites. It involves using software program applications or scripts to obtain Websites, extract particular data, and retail outlet it in the structured format for further Investigation or use.

In today's details-driven world, corporations, researchers, and people today usually need to collect big quantities of facts from several on-line resources. Internet scraping presents a strong Alternative to proficiently obtain and organize this worthwhile information and facts. By automating the process, World-wide-web scraping eliminates the need for guide copying and pasting, conserving effort and time while making certain accuracy and regularity.

Being familiar with Internet Scraping
Net scraping is definitely the practice of extracting information from Sites applying automatic program or scripts. These applications can navigate through web pages, parse the HTML or other structured data formats, and extract the desired info. The extracted information can then be stored in a databases, spreadsheet, or another acceptable structure for even more processing or Investigation.

As an instance how World wide web scraping performs, let us contemplate a simple case in point. Visualize you should gather pricing information and facts for a certain merchandise from numerous e-commerce websites. Manually viewing Just about every Site, finding the merchandise, and copying the price facts will be a time-consuming and mistake-susceptible endeavor. With Net scraping, you can develop a script that immediately visits Every single website, locates the merchandise web site, and extracts the pertinent pricing facts.

Key Factors of Web Scraping
World wide web scraping will involve a number of essential parts:

Web Crawler: A method or script that automatically navigates via Sites by pursuing hyperlinks and retrieving Web content.
HTML Parser: A part that analyzes the composition and content of HTML or other structured data formats to determine and extract the desired information.
Data Extraction: The entire process of extracting precise facts things with the Websites, for example text, pictures, links, or tables, based on predefined rules or designs.
Info Storage: The extracted information is often saved inside a structured format, such as a databases, CSV file, or spreadsheet, for more analysis or processing.
Why is Website Scraping Critical?
Net scraping features quite a few Advantages and apps across several industries and domains. Here are a few explanation why World-wide-web scraping is vital:

Data Aggregation: World wide web scraping enables you to accumulate data from several resources and consolidate it into an individual, structured structure for Evaluation or determination-making.
Industry Investigate: Businesses can use World wide web scraping to collect insights about competition, pricing traits, item testimonials, and shopper sentiments.
Rate Checking: Web scraping enables genuine-time tracking of costs across numerous e-commerce platforms, aiding organizations remain competitive and make informed pricing decisions.
Guide Technology: By extracting Get hold of facts and various applicable facts from Sites, firms can create prospects and determine prospective customers.
Academic Investigate: Researchers can leverage Internet scraping to gather info for research, surveys, or Assessment in several fields, which include social sciences, economics, and linguistics.
Information Aggregation: Internet scraping is often accustomed to mixture information posts, weblog posts, or other on line content from various resources for articles curation or Assessment.
Authorized and Ethical Criteria
When Internet scraping may be a robust tool, It can be necessary to be aware of and comply with the authorized and moral considerations associated. Below are a few essential points to bear in mind:

Phrases of Service: Numerous Sites have phrases of assistance that prohibit or prohibit World-wide-web scraping things to do. It's essential to evaluation and comply with these conditions to avoid opportunity lawful challenges.
Mental Residence Rights: Respect copyrights along with other intellectual assets legal rights when scraping knowledge from Internet sites. Stay away from scraping and distributing copyrighted content material with out authorization.
Facts Privateness: Be conscious of information privacy guidelines and restrictions, especially when scraping own or sensitive info.
Server Load: Too much or aggressive World-wide-web scraping can spot a significant load on an internet site's servers, potentially resulting in overall performance challenges or support disruptions. It is really important to carry out measures to guarantee your scraping actions tend not to overburden the target Internet sites.
Finest Practices for World wide web Scraping
To be certain moral and responsible Net scraping techniques, consider the following greatest procedures:

Regard Robots.txt: The robots.txt file on an internet site specifies which parts are off-restrictions to Website crawlers. Adhere to those rules and steer clear of scraping restricted areas.
Apply Crawl Delays: Introduce intentional delays in between requests to prevent overpowering the target website's servers.
Identify You: Lots of Internet websites have mechanisms to establish and perhaps block scraping routines. Contemplate identifying your scraper during the consumer-agent string or supplying Get in touch with information and facts for transparency.
Receive Consent: When scraping info from websites that have to have authentication or entail delicate details, think about acquiring explicit consent or permission from the web site homeowners or relevant events.
Use Proxies or Rotating IP Addresses: To stay away from IP blocking or charge-restricting measures, consider using proxies or rotating IP addresses in your scraping actions.
Adjust to Data Privacy Rules: Ensure that your World wide web scraping tactics comply with applicable info privateness guidelines and laws, like the Normal Details Protection Regulation (GDPR) or the California Buyer Privacy Act (CCPA).
Conclusion
World-wide-web scraping is a robust system that allows the automatic extraction of knowledge from websites. It offers numerous Advantages and programs across numerous industries, from industry analysis and price tag monitoring to academic study and content material aggregation. Nevertheless, It is crucial to understand and adjust to authorized and ethical criteria, regard intellectual assets legal rights, and put into action very best practices to guarantee accountable and sustainable Internet scraping things to do.

By adhering to the recommendations outlined on this page, it is possible to leverage the power of World wide web scraping whilst reducing possible challenges and sustaining a favourable connection While using the Sites you connect with. Because the digital landscape proceeds to evolve, web scraping will continue to be an a must have tool for info-driven conclusion-creating and investigation.

soft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os

Report this page